2020/6/27配置WEB服务、FTP服务、Wang.bin@inspur.comInspurgroupIIS安装和配置2020年6月27日32020/6/27Inspurgroup一、IIS的安装添加程序添加组件42020/6/27InspurgroupIIS具体内容选择IIS详细选择服务管理二、IIS服务的属性选择服务带宽限制IIS服务(Internet信息服务)内置(W3C)服务和FTP服务管理工具启动IIS服务62020/6/27Inspurgroup三、新建Web站点站点说明分配地址分配端口72020/6/27InspurgroupWEB站点设置主目录路径权限设置完成只在Win2000Server以上版本有效82020/6/27Inspurgroup四、Web站点属性连接超时启动启动或停止主目录和默认文档主目录文档102020/6/27Inspurgroup五、增加虚拟目录名称112020/6/27Inspurgroup虚拟目录设置目录路径权限设置完成122020/6/27Inspurgroup六、虚拟目录的属性虚拟目录默认文档132020/6/27Inspurgroup虚拟目录安全性修改访问限制修改IP限制只在Win2000Server以上版本有效142020/6/27InspurgroupFTP简介(Demo2)创建FTP服务器管理FTP服务器多个FTP服务器的实现FTP客户端程序152020/6/27Inspurgroup第七节FTP简介文件传输协议FTP(FileTransferProtocol)是Internet上使用最广泛的文件传送协议。它允许用户将文件从一台计算机传输到另一台计算机上,并且能保证传输的可靠性。由于采用TCP/IP协议作为Internet的基本协议。无论两台Internet上的计算机在地理位置上相距多远,只要它们都支持FTP协议,就可以相互传送文件。这样做不仅可以节省实时联机的通信费用,而且可以方便地阅读与处理传输过来的文件。同时,采用FTP传输文件时,不需要对文件进行复杂的转换,因此具有较高的效率。162020/6/27Inspurgroup一、FTP的功能FTP的主要功能包括两个方面:文件的下载和文件的上传文件的下载就是将远程服务器上提供的文件下载到本地计算机上。文件的上传是指客户机可以将任意类型的文件上传到指定的FTP服务器上。FTP服务支持文件上传和下载,而HTTP仅支持文件的下载功能。172020/6/27Inspurgroup二、FTP服务的工作过程FTP服务采用典型的客户/服务器工作模式FTP服务器默认设置两个端口21和20:端口21用于监听FTP客户机的连接请求,端口20用于传输文件。182020/6/27Inspurgroup三、FTP的访问方式FTP服务分为普通FTP与匿名FTP服务两种类型。普通FTP服务要求用户在登录时提供正确的用户名和用户密码。匿名FTP服务的实质是提供服务的机构在它的FTP服务器上建立一个公开账号(通常为anonymous),并赋予该账号访问公共目录的权限。192020/6/27InspurgroupDemo2实验名称:使用IIS6.0创建FTP站点实验目的:IIS6.0是WindowsServer2003自带的一款应用程序,通过使用IIS6.0,我们可以建立自己的FTP站点202020/6/27Inspurgroup第八节创建FTP服务器在WindowsServer2003提供的IIS6.0服务器中内嵌了FTP服务器软件。在WindowsServer2003的默认安装过程中是没有安装的,手动安装FTP服务器的步骤如下:(1)执行“开始”→“控制面板”→“添加/删除程序”→“添加/删除Windows组件”。(2)在Windows组件向导界面,在“组件”列表框中选中“应用程序服务器”选项。212020/6/27InspurgroupWindows组件——应用程序服务器详细信息222020/6/27Inspurgroup应用程序服务器——Internet信息服务232020/6/27InspurgroupInternet信息服务——文件传输协议(FTP)服务242020/6/27Inspurgroup第九节管理FTP服务器252020/6/27Inspurgroup一、配置“FTP站点”选项卡262020/6/27Inspurgroup启用日志记录参数272020/6/27Inspurgroup单击“当前会话”按钮,打开“FTP用户会话”对话282020/6/27Inspurgroup二、配置“安全账户”选项卡292020/6/27Inspurgroup三、配置“消息”选项卡302020/6/27Inspurgroup四、配置“主目录”选项卡312020/6/27Inspurgroup五、配置“目录安全性”选项卡322020/6/27Inspurgroup第十节多个FTP服务器的实现创建多个FTP服务器,这些FTP服务器利用同一个IP地址,不同的TCP端口332020/6/27Inspurgroup新建FTP站点向导欢迎界面342020/6/27InspurgroupFTP站点描述352020/6/27InspurgroupIP地址和端口设置362020/6/27InspurgroupFTP用户隔离372020/6/27InspurgroupFTP站点主目录382020/6/27InspurgroupFTP站点访问权限392020/6/27Inspurgroup第十一节FTP客户端程序常用的FTP客户端程序通常有三种类型:传统的FTP命令行、浏览器与FTP下载工具。一、使用传统FTP命令行访问FTP站点常用的命令格式如下:1.ftp主机名2.FTPbye结束与远程计算机的FTP会话并退出ftp。3.FTPcd更改远程计算机上的工作目录。4.FTPdelete删除远程计算机上的文件402020/6/27Inspurgroup5.open主机名端口412020/6/27Inspurgroup6.FTPdir显示远程目录文件和子目录列表7.FTPget使用当前文件转换类型将远程文件复制到本地计算机。格式:getremote-file[local-file]8.FTPhelp[command]9.FTPls显示远程目录文件和子目录的缩写列表。10.FTPmkdir创建远程目录11.FTPmls显示远程目录文件和子目录的缩写列表12.FTPmput使用当前文件传送类型将本地文件复制到远程计算机上。422020/6/27Inspurgroup13.FTPput使用当前文件传送类型将本地文件复制到远程计算机上。14.FTPpwd显示远程计算机上的当前目录15.FTPquit结束与远程计算机的FTP会话并退出ftp。16.FTPrmdir删除远程目录17.FTPuser指定远程计算机的用户432020/6/27Inspurgroup二、利用IE浏览器访问FTP站点利用IE6.0访问FTP站点的方法如下:若要访问的FTP站点为匿名站点,在IE浏览器的地址栏输入“域名”。如果FTP站点提供的是用户访问的方法,在IE浏览器的地址栏中需要添加用户名和密码信息,格式为:“ftp://用户名:密码@FTP站点的IP地址或DNS域名”。也可以按照匿名访问的方法进行访问,IE浏览器会自动弹出登录身份窗口,提示输入用户名和密码。